Post by The Franchise Tue Mar 26, 2013 10:53 pm

Stopping crosses is not easy, come on now.

If Varane didnt try and block it, im with you, his bad.

But he did the try, the ball went past him..nothing much he could do. He closed it down without getting tight enough to get beat.

The real issue on that goal is before then. Pedro came deep, Evra allowed him time to do it, he played a long pass over Jallet who's starting position was kind of questionable...then Pedro ran in the box and got on the end of the ball, Evra beaten twice by movement there. Not good enough. If you let Pedro have the ball in front, you sure as hell better not get beat when he makes his second run...he did.

Post by The Franchise Tue Mar 26, 2013 11:17 pm

If anything Pogba's perfomance today only solidifies his talent and shows how much of a future he has.

He did some superb things out there, showed great composure and defended very well where he could.

If Spain "ran rings around him" (they didnt) its because they had more options on the ball so they could make passes...but not often did they go directly past him via the dribble.

He did very little individually wrong and he can actually play the number 4 in the future if he wanted I believe.
